Ingenious Team Building Concepts With Philanthropic Initiatives
By integrating kind efforts into group building, you can create unique experiences that not just reinforce bonds among employee yet also make a favorable influence on the area. Take into consideration arranging a charity walk or run where your team can raise funds for a local cause while delighting in some fresh air with each other. Alternatively, volunteer at a food bank, enabling your group to team up in a significant method while sustaining those in demand.
You could likewise hold a skills-sharing workshop, where staff member show each various other important skills and afterwards contribute the earnings to a philanthropic company. An additional idea is to companion with neighborhood schools for mentorship programs, where staff members can guide pupils and share their competence. These ingenious activities not only boost synergy yet also foster a feeling of function, making your company society extra thoughtful and involved.

Measuring Staff Member Involvement Degrees
Measuring employee involvement levels after participating in kind campaigns provides valuable understandings right into how these tasks affect team characteristics. You can use studies and comments sessions to evaluate staff members' sensations and perceptions concerning their experiences. Tracking involvement rates, excitement during occasions, and post-activity conversations can likewise reveal just how engaged group participants feel.
Additionally, look for adjustments in collaboration and communication amongst group members. Eventually, higher engagement degrees can lead to boosted morale, efficiency, and a more powerful feeling of community within the group.
